@charset "utf-8";
/* CSS Document */
body { background-image:url(../images/BGs/tlrMastHead_BG_2010.jpg); margin: 0px auto 10px 0px; font-size: 11px; font-family: Verdana, Arial, Helvetica, sans-serif; color:#CCCCCC; background-color:#000000; background-repeat: no-repeat; background-position: top; }
.txtStndSubHead	{ font:Verdana, Arial, Helvetica, sans-serif 14px bold; padding-left:18; color:#CCCCCC; }
.txtModel	{ font:Verdana, Arial, Helvetica, sans-serif 14px italic normal; padding-left:18; color:#CCCCCC; }
.txtStnd	{ font:Verdana, Arial, Helvetica, sans-serif 11px normal; color:#CCCCCC; }
.txtStandard{ font:Verdana, Arial, Helvetica, sans-serif 11px normal; color:#000000; }
.txtSpecial	{ font:Verdana, Arial, Helvetica, sans-serif 14px bold; color:#FFCC00; }
.txtRetail	{ font:Verdana, Arial, Helvetica, sans-serif 14px bold; color:#CCCCCC; }
.txtNote 	{font: "Comic Sans MS", cursive  9px italic normal; color:#999; text-decoration:none;}
/*font: bold 10px Verdana, Arial;*/
.styleRed2 {color: #FF0000}
.txtBody { font-family: Arial, Helvetica, sans-serif; font-size:12px; list-style-type: decimal; color: #cccccc; }
.txtRed { font-family: Verdana, Arial, Helvetica, sans-serif; color: #FF0000; }
.miniRed { font-family: Verdana, Arial, Helvetica, sans-serif; font-size:9px; color:#F30; }

.HedBrandDept {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 80%; text-transform: uppercase; color:#999999; letter-spacing: px; }

H1	{ font-family:Arial, Helvetica, sans-serif; color:#CCCCCC;	}

H2	{ font-family:Arial, Helvetica, sans-serif;	color:#FFCC33;	}
	
p	{ font-family:Verdana, Arial, Helvetica, sans-serif; font-size:14px; color:#CCCCCC; }
TD.BG	{ background-position:top; background-repeat:no-repeat; }	
.pL	{ background-color:#333333; }

/* All the link styles- including standard link and 4 menu styles A,B,Home & Bk(back) */
 	a:link          { color:#F00; text-decoration:none; }
    a:visited       { color:#900; text-decoration:none; }
    a:hover         { color:#FFCC00; text-decoration:underline; }
    a:active        { color:#FF3300; text-decoration:underline; }
	
.menuBG	{background-image:url(../images/BGs/menuBG_5x40.jpg); background-repeat:repeat-x; background-position:top;}
.menuA	{font-family:Verdana; font-size:16px; padding:0px 15px 0px 15px; border-right:1px solid #999; }
 	a.menuA:link    { color:#999999;text-decoration:none; }
    a.menuA:visited { color:#999999;text-decoration:none; }
    a.menuA:hover   { color:#FFCC00;text-decoration:none; }
    a.menuA:active  { color:#FFFFFF;text-decoration:none; }
	
.menuB	{font-family:Verdana;font-size:14px;padding-left:20px; margin-bottom:40px; }
    a.menuB:link    { color:#999999;text-decoration:none; }
    a.menuB:visited { color:#999999;text-decoration:none; }
    a.menuB:hover   { color:#FFCC00;text-decoration:none; }
    a.menuB:active  { color:#FFFFFF;text-decoration:none; }
	
.menuRed	{font-family:Verdana;font-size:14px;padding-left:20px; margin-bottom:40px; }
    a.menuB:link    { color:#F00;text-decoration:none; }
    a.menuB:visited { color:#999999;text-decoration:none; }
    a.menuB:hover   { color:#FFCC00;text-decoration:none; }
    a.menuB:active  { color:#FFFFFF;text-decoration:none; }

.menuBk { font-family:Verdana; font-size:11px;padding-left:30px; font-style:italic; }
    a.menuBk:link    { color:#666666;text-decoration:none; }
    a.menuBk:visited { color:#666666;text-decoration:none; }
    a.menuBk:hover   { color:#FFCC00;text-decoration:none; }
    a.menuBk:active  { color:#FFFFFF;text-decoration:none; }

.menuHome	{font-family:Verdana; font-size:16px; padding:0px 50px 0px 50px; }
 	a.menuHome:link    { color:#999999;text-decoration:none; }
    a.menuHome:visited { color:#999999;text-decoration:none;	}
    a.menuHome:hover   { color:#FFCC00;text-decoration:none; }
    a.menuHome:active  { color:#FFFFFF;text-decoration:none; }
	
	

hr.cb {color:#666666; width:100%; height:1px; }
	
/*imageslider*/
/*preload classes*/
.svw { width: 50px; height: 20px; background: #000; }
.svw ul {position: relative; left: -999em;}
/*core classes*/
.stripViewer { position:relative; overflow:hidden; border:1px solid #999; /* #ff0000; */ margin:0 0 1px 0; }
.stripViewer ul { /* this is your UL of images */ margin:0; padding:0; position:relative; left:0; top:0; width:1%; list-style-type none; }
.stripViewer ul li { float:left; }
.stripTransmitter { overflow: auto; width: 1%; }
.stripTransmitter ul { margin: 0; padding: 0; position: relative; list-style-type: none; }
.stripTransmitter ul li{ width: 20px; float:left; margin: 0 1px 1px 0; }
.stripTransmitter a{ font: bold 10px Verdana, Arial; text-align: center; line-height: 22px; background: #000; color: #fff; text-decoration: none; display: block; }
.stripTransmitter a:hover, a.current{ background: #000; color: #666; }

/*tooltips formatting*/
#tooltip { background: #fff; color: #000; opacity: 0.85; border: 5px solid #8d8dfd; }
#tooltip h3 { font: normal 10px Verdana; margin: 3px; padding: 6px 2px; border: 0; }

/*checkbag TLR */
/*.BG_tableShadow { background-attachment: fixed; background-image: none; background-repeat: repeat-y; background-position: right top; border: 1px solid #999 }*/

